Prioritize Security Alerts and Automate Remediation Playbooks

AI ingests alerts and contextual telemetry to rank incidents by likely business impact, recommend step-by-step remediations, and safely trigger automated actions with human approvals-reducing analyst triage time and mean time to resolution.

Illustrative example only. Every workflow requires its own operational, quality, and risk review.

Before: the work today

Security operations centers in financial services face large volumes of alerts from SIEM, EDR, IAM and cloud controls. High noise, fragmented context, and manual investigation create backlog, increase SLA breaches, and pull senior analysts into repetitive tasks rather than proactive risk reduction.

Change: a better workflow

Build a layered AI-assisted triage and orchestration pipeline that combines statistical models for anomaly scoring with retrieval-augmented LLMs for contextual playbooks and a controlled SOAR integration for execution. Start with a pilot on high-value alert classes (credential anomalies, lateral movement, privileged access changes) and iterate with analysts in the loop to calibrate thresholds and validations.

  • Ingest: centralize SIEM, EDR, IAM, network telemetry, ticketing and asset inventory to provide unified context for each alert.
  • Models: use supervised and unsupervised ML to score likelihood and business impact; use retrieval-augmented generation to produce concise remediation steps and evidence summaries.
  • Human-in-the-loop: present ranked incidents and suggested playbooks in analyst workflow; require step or playbook approval for automated actions, with an escalation path for uncertain cases.
  • Orchestration & controls: integrate with SOAR for gated automation (quarantine, credential reset, block IP) and log every action for audit and rollback.
  • Governance: implement validation datasets, continuous monitoring of precision/recall, escalation SLAs, and an explainability log for compliance reviews.
